Not all programs are easily removed from a computer.
Apart from the folder containing the main files, applications can write temporary data to another location and store error reports elsewhere.
Thoughtful developers offer an option during uninstallation: to save or delete temporary files and program settings data. However, malicious or negligent authors may leave some files on the computer when uninstalling.
Over time, such 'remnants' accumulate, cluttering the system. This document discusses utilities for Windows, macOS, and Linux that help remove unnecessary programs and files, leaving no superfluous items on the disc.

The Necessity of Forced File Deletion
For modern computers, especially those running macOS and Linux, external cleaning utilities are mostly unnecessary: the system manages everything independently. Hence, I only recommend using additional programs if nothing else works.
Besides cleaning up unnecessary files from the removed software, uninstallers - as these program-removing tools are known - serve two more crucial functions.
Deleting Undeletable Files. In rare instances, the system may prevent the deletion of certain files. Here are some reasons why:
- The file is being used by another program. For instance, a photo can't be deleted from a disk if it's open in a photo editor.
- The file has already been deleted. Occasionally, the system might lag and not register the deletion immediately - you can try deleting it again, but this won't yield any results.
- You don't have sufficient permissions to delete the file. For example, if you are using a work or school PC without admin rights, you can open files, but you can't delete them.
- The program has frozen.
- The file resides in a protected folder, and the system deems it important for the computer's operation.
Even a uninstaller can't delete a file if it's open in the download manager.
Typically, opening a file as an administrator will solve the problem, and you won't need to have a face-to-face conversation with anyone.
Each program on the list can handle any locked files, except for system files. Sometimes, even these need to be deleted; for example, if a driver was installed incorrectly and it's sabotaging the system.
Program Installation Control. Utilities are easier to delete if you know exactly where their files are stored. For this, the uninstaller keeps track of which folders appear and get filled when new programs are installed. When the program is uninstalled, the uninstaller checks the list and clears all the folders at once.Β
Safe Mode
Convenience:Β πππππ
Effectiveness:Β πͺπͺπͺ
Operating System:Β Windows
Cost:Β Free
You may not need a separate program to uninstall software. If a file is inaccessible due to admin permissions or is in use by another program, booting in Safe Mode might be sufficient.
Safe Mode is a specific way of starting Windows, where only the bare minimum of necessary programs and services are activated. It's ideal for a system infected with viruses. Particularly persistent viruses may block admin access to files, which can't be unlocked even through the command line, but Safe Mode bypasses these restrictions.
Access the recovery settings or use the link ms-settings:recovery by pressing Win + R.
In Safe Mode, just delete the file as usual. Your computer will only run the necessary processes for operation, so nothing should conflict with the deletion.
If this method doesn't work, you'll have to resort to third-party programs.

Ashampoo Uninstaller
Convenience: ππππ Effectiveness: πͺπͺπͺπͺ Operating System: Windows Cost: $40 per year (with a need for VPN and foreign bank card), free trial version available
Ashampoo Uninstaller, a product from a renowned utility software manufacturer, provides a free trial version that is sufficient for basic uninstallation of programs and circumvention of system constraints.
Furthermore, it offers a program rating system. If it identifies any malicious or unreliable software among the installed ones, the Uninstaller will alert you.
The paid version unlocks a set of advanced features:
- Installation Control: By dragging the installer into the utility, the program installs within Ashampoo, enabling easy removal later.
- Removal of Pre-installed Windows Programs: This feature allows you to uninstall built-in Microsoft messenger, defender, game client, and other non-essential utilities. However, they might reappear after a system update.
- Process Monitoring: By clicking on any running process, you can trace which program controls it. This is handy when a file is used by multiple programs, and you need to identify them.
- Browser Plugin Removal: Though this can be handled without the program, it's an added convenience.
The software performs its functions effectively, removing all files, registry entries, and temporary folders. However, some users complain about the incorrect operation of the built-in installer, which poorly tracks programs if the computer needs to be restarted at the end of installation.
Registry Cleaning Has Minimal Impact on System Performance
Sometimes, the ability to clean registry data is used as a criterion to evaluate the program. However, registry entries do not heavily burden the computer, and it's generally not necessary to tamper with them.
The only scenario where registry editing is indeed required is when you want to remove a virus or malicious program from it.

Soft Organizer
User-friendliness: πππππ
Effectiveness: πͺπͺπͺπͺ
Operating System: Windows
Cost: Free, with a Pro version available for $40 (needs VPN and a foreign bank card for purchase)
Soft Organizer, even in its free version, efficiently removes residual files of programs, rids your system of default Windows utilities, and creates backup copies in case the removed software turns out to be crucially important.
Here's what the paid version offers additionally:
- It allows you to search for remnants of previously removed programs, ensuring a thorough cleaning of your computer.
- It lets you install programs with tracking, facilitating more effective removal later.
- It updates programs, a function whose necessity in a deinstaller is debatable.
Some users complain that the program struggles with forgotten registry entries and recommend pairing it with an additional utility for their removal.

Bulk Crap Uninstaller
Convenience: πππππ
Effectiveness: πͺπͺπͺπͺπͺ
Operating System: Windows
Cost: Free
Bulk Crap Uninstaller is a free, open-source program that doesn't require installation. The developers earn through donations, ensuring that the program remains free without any hidden costs.
Despite its name, Bulk Crap Uninstaller is a sophisticated uninstaller. While it doesn't manage the installation of applications, it offers the following features:
- It assigns a user rating to each program. The reliability of a program can be seen directly in the list, represented by stars. These ratings are trustworthy as the developers don't receive payments for high-rated programs.
- It can hide system files and those not intended for deletion. Hence, the program offers an advanced 'foolproof' system. If you're unsure about uninstalling, checkboxes help determine how crucial a program is to the system.
- It clears registry entries. An individual button is responsible for this - mentions of the utility in the registry can be removed with a single click.
Users occasionally complain about the program's occasional misses in file removal and missed registry entries. However, the utility handles its tasks better than some paid counterparts.
While BCU may not have the friendliest interface, it is free from advertisements and doesn't push other developer products.

AppCleaner
Convenience: πππ
Effectiveness: πͺπͺπͺ
Operating System: macOS
Cost: Free
AppCleaner is a minimalist, user-friendly, and free utility tool. The application is funded by donations, ensuring user data privacy.
To delete a file, simply drag it into the AppCleaner program, and it will automatically secure all required permissions for its deletion. In recent versions, a file search function and a list of all programs have been added for increased efficiency.
Besides deletion, AppCleaner can search for associated files to ensure comprehensive removal of all residual files after uninstallation.
AppCleaner is often lauded as the best free uninstallation tool in reviews and user feedback.

CleanMyMac
Convenience: πππππ Effectiveness: πͺπͺπͺ Operating System: macOS Cost: $35 per year, free version available
CleanMyMac, a software solution from developers specializing in Mac cleanup tools, provides multifunctional features, although some users have critiqued it for creating an illusion of work. It appears to clean everything possible on your computer, including:
- App cache.
- Old images.
- Service files from deleted programs.
- Trash bin.
- Temporary iTunes files.
The software also includes a detailed uninstaller that removes software from the disk and searches for related files, ensuring 100% removal of unnecessary components. Advanced installation is not available.
Some users consider CleanMyMac to be an unnecessary program, mainly because macOS is well-organized by default and usually doesn't require an additional multitool.
However, it's worth noting that the uninstaller in CleanMyMac thoroughly removes programs, files, and all their records, including duplicates and related files, which implies that the software performs its tasks effectively.

Stacer
Convenience: ππ Effectiveness: πͺπͺπͺπͺπͺ Operating System: Linux Cost: Free
Stacer is an open-source application for Linux. You can install it without even clicking the above link, by simply typing the following three commands in the command line:
- sudo add-apt-repository ppa:oguzhaninan/stacersudo apt-get updatesudo apt-get install stacer
The uninstaller within Stacer is incredibly straightforward: you can select the desired package or group of packages and remove them with ease.
Users generally express satisfaction with the program, praising its speedy operation and user-friendly interface. The only word of caution is that it can potentially remove important system files, so careful use is advised.

Czkawka
Convenience: ππππ
Effectiveness: πͺπͺπͺπͺ
Operating System: Linux, Windows, macOS
Cost: Free
Czkawka is an open-source application designed for Linux, aimed at managing files, disks, and indexing. It is also available for Windows and macOS but there are compelling alternatives available for these platforms. Here's what the utility can do:
- Search and delete duplicate, empty, temporary, and large files.
- Seek similar images, videos, and music.
- Detect incorrect file names and permissions.
Essentially, the entire application functions as a comprehensive uninstaller with various options. According to user reviews, the software operates flawlessly and is frequently updated.
